Subject: [PATCH 5/5] ARM: dts: stm32: Add wakeup management on stm32mp15x UART nodes
Date: Fri, 19 Mar 2021 19:42:53 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210319184253.5841-6-erwan.leray@foss.st.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210319184253.5841-1-erwan.leray@foss.st.com>

Add EXTI lines to the following UART nodes which are used for
wakeup from CStop.
- EXTI line 26 to USART1
- EXTI line 27 to USART2
- EXTI line 28 to USART3
- EXTI line 29 to USART6
- EXTI line 30 to UART4
- EXTI line 31 to UART5
- EXTI line 32 to UART7
- EXTI line 33 to UART8
